一、Docker 简介
Docker 是一款开源的应用容器化引擎,可以将应用程序和它们的依赖项打包到一个称为容器的可移植容器中,从而实现打包、发布、和运行任何应用程序的目的。Docker 非常流行,其主要原因在于它可以帮助开发人员简化应用程序的构建和部署过程。
通过容器化技术,我们创建的应用程序具有很强的可移植性,它可以在任何地方运行,只需要安装相应的 Docker 引擎即可。因此,Docker 被广泛应用于云计算、DevOps 等领域。
二、CentOS8 Docker 的优点
CentOS8 是一款非常流行的 Linux 发行版,具有稳定、安全、易用等优点。而 Docker 则可以将应用程序和它们的依赖项打包成容器形式,从而实现应用程序的构建、部署、运行等方面的优化。
下面我们介绍 CentOS8 Docker 的优点:
1.一致的运行环境
通过 Docker,我们可以创建一个与宿主操作系统独立的运行环境,即应用程序所依赖的软件和库与宿主操作系统是隔离的,从而保证应用程序能够在不同的计算机上运行。
2.更高效的资源利用
由于 Docker 的容器化技术,可以将应用程序和它们的依赖项完全隔离,从而实现更高效的资源利用,同时也能够提高应用程序的运行效率。
3.更快的部署速度
通过 Docker,我们可以将应用程序打包成一个容器形式,从而实现快速、统一、可重复的部署,减少了因为环境问题导致的部署失败的概率。
三、CentOS8 Docker 的安装
1.安装 Docker
# 安装所需的依赖包 yum install -y yum-utils device-mapper-persistent-data lvm2 # 设置 Docker CE 的稳定软件库 yum-config-manager --add-repo https://download.docker.com/linux/centos/docker-ce.repo # 安装 Docker CE yum install docker-ce
2.启动 Docker
# 启动 Docker systemctl start docker # 设置 Docker 开机自启动 systemctl enable docker
四、CentOS8 Docker 的使用
下面我们介绍 CentOS8 Docker 的使用方法:
1.搜索 Docker 镜像
# 搜索 Docker 镜像 docker search 镜像名称
2.拉取 Docker 镜像
# 拉取 Docker 镜像 docker pull 镜像名称
3.查看 Docker 镜像
# 查看 Docker 镜像 docker images
4.运行 Docker 容器
# 运行 Docker 容器 docker run -it 镜像名称
5.查看 Docker 容器
# 查看 Docker 容器 docker ps -a
6.停止 Docker 容器
# 停止 Docker 容器 docker stop 容器 ID
7.删除 Docker 容器
# 删除 Docker 容器 docker rm 容器 ID
五、小结
本文详细介绍了 CentOS8 Docker 的相关知识,包括 Docker 的介绍、CentOS8 Docker 的优点、CentOS8 Docker 的安装与使用等方面,希望本文能够帮助初学者更好地了解 CentOS8 Docker,从而更好地应用和运用 Docker 技术。